CLASS OF '45 Main evenTs oT The year Tor The class of '45 were The ChrisTmas drive, in which The iunior booTh won The second prize Tor boTh quanTiTy and percenTage: The iunior assembly which exhibiTed The abundance oT TalenT in The class: and The Junior-Senior Prom, big- gesT social evenT oT The year. Junior class oTTicers Tor The year I943-I944 were president Bill Eldredg vice-president Neil SnorTum: secreTary, Elaine Walker: and Treasurer, Lois ChrisTensen.
